HC Deb 24 June 1941 vol 372 c961W
Mr. Groves

asked the Minister of Labour whether all persons who have been admitted, or duly accepted for admission, as students by recognised medical schools are, subject to certain conditions, reserved from military service, irrespective of age; and, if not, what is the maximum age of reservation for such students?

Mr. Bevin

Subject to the conditions of satisfactory progress in their studies and the performance of part-time national service, a medical student (being a person who has been admitted or duly accepted for admission as a student by a recognised medical school, i.e., the faculty of medicine of a university, or a medical school of a university, or a school of medicine providing courses of study recognised by a licensing body) is reserved at all ages from Military Service.
